The Delhi Police official's candid assessment of Parliament security vulnerabilities marks a departure from the typical institutional silence that surrounds such sensitive operations. According to the account, the police feared that any breach of the outer security perimeter could cascade into a larger institutional failure—not merely as a direct security threat, but as a psychological and operational domino effect that would compromise the entire multi-layered security architecture protecting Parliament and the politicians within it.
This fear, the official explained, is rooted in operational reality rather than theoretical anxiety. Parliament security operates on a principle of concentric circles—each layer designed to catch breaches that slip through the previous one. However, each layer also relies on the psychological integrity of the outer rings. A single protester successfully penetrating the outermost cordon doesn't just represent one individual inside a restricted zone; it signals to subsequent security personnel that the system itself has a flaw. In high-stress security operations, such signals translate into hesitation, second-guessing, and the kind of operational friction that creates genuine vulnerabilities.
The revelation underscores a critical gap between how institutional security is often portrayed in public discourse and how it actually functions on the ground. Security frameworks protecting critical infrastructure are not monolithic barriers but probabilistic systems designed to raise the cost of intrusion while accepting that no system is perfectly impenetrable. The Delhi Police's assessment suggests that their actual concern is not preventing all breaches—an impossible task—but maintaining the operational and psychological coherence of the security apparatus itself.
